Im überarbeiteten Add-on fehlt jetzt noch die Anzeige des HTML-Status, welche man bisher unten in der Statusleiste sehen (und umschalten) konnte. Direkt in der Statusleiste ist dies bisher mit WebExtension-Code nicht möglich. Ich möchte dafür auch keinen weiteren Code in einer Experiment-API nutzen - dies sollte auf das wirklich zentral Notwendige beschränkt bleiben, denke ich.
Ich hätte eine Idee, wie man das Problem lösen könnte:
Den bisherigen AHT-Button gibt es im Grunde doppelt, da dieser sowohl in der Haupt-Symbolleiste als auch in der Kopfzeilen-Symbolleiste vorhanden ist. Man könnte den Button aus der Haupt-Symbolleiste entfernen und statt dessen dort einen neuen Button "HTML-Modus" einbauen. Dieser Button könnte dann wieder mittels der verschiedenen Icons (farbig, grau oder schwarz-weiß) den Status der HTML-Einstellung zeigen. Außerdem könnte dieser neue Button ein Popup-Menü bieten, worin man den HTML-Modus dann manuell umschalten kann. Damit wäre alles erfüllt, was bisher das Element in der Statusleiste unten geboten hatte. Allerdings ist der "browserAction"-Button (so nennt der sich im WebExtension-Code) für die Hauptsymbolleiste nur im 3-Pane-Window verfügbar, wenn ich nicht irre. Übrigens sind per WebExtension leider keine 2 (oder mehr) Buttons mehr möglich, die man für die Symbolleisten anbieten könnte. Es geht also jeweils nur noch ein Button pro Symbolleiste.
Ein "Mockup" der Idee:
[mark]Ich kann Eure Meinungen und Ideen diesbezüglich gebrauchen![/mark]